Management Meeting Minutes — Fernhollow Pilot

Attendees: ops, product, sales leadership. Pilot with Fernhollow Stores approved: twelve locations, eight weeks. Success metrics: sell-through rate and restock frequency. Sales leads to assign regional coverage by Friday. No public communication until pilot concludes. Budget approved as presented. The strategic intent behind the pilot is set out in the note below.

internal memo for yahof-bajop: Tamethox Group is in early talks to buy Ulamirek Group for about $64.0 million. The Aldiel launch date is October 11, and nothing goes to the press before then.

The Brightline reseller programme closed the half-year ahead of plan, with channel revenue up 11% and margin within target. Onboarding costs ran slightly high due to extended training at the Carrowby branch. Rebate accruals are adequately reserved. Branch managers should note that tier thresholds will be recalibrated next quarter, and stock allocations will follow the revised demand model. Performance dashboards update weekly. The confidential note on related business plans is provided below.

internal memo for yahag-tahog: The pricing group signed off on a budget of $152.8 million for Project Soriel.

MINUTES — Capacity Decision, Gretlow Works

Attendees: Sana Ollert, Piers Dunmow, Freya Kask.

We've agreed to add a night shift at Gretlow rather than expand the Velmor site — cheaper and faster. Piers will sort tooling; Freya handles scheduling. Review in six weeks. The reasoning ties into the plans noted just below.

board note of fahag-tajop: The eastern region missed its Julix quota by 44.0 percent last quarter. Ralionax Holdings plans to lower the Druath list price by 61.8 percent in March. The board signed off on a budget of $295.0 million for Project Gilath. The renewal with Ruswynix Systems closes at $274.5 million a year, 17.0 percent above the last contract.